Job Description

Join Leidos' Offensive Cyber Operations Team

Leidos, a leader in national security innovation, seeks Senior Reverse/Embedded Software Engineers for our Offensive Cyber Operation (OCO) team in Columbia, MD. With 47,000 employees delivering cutting-edge solutions, we're building foundational toolkits to detect, deny, degrade, disrupt, and deceive targets. Our tools have supported hundreds of real-world missions targeting routers, switches, and more.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op evasion techniques against host-based and network intrusion detection systems.
  • Build software for raw network traffic capture, analysis, and interpretation.
  • Master network socket programming with deep IP, TCP, and application protocol expertise.
  • Reverse engineer hardware/software, especially network devices, to exploit vulnerabilities.
  • Design capabilities from requirements and document detailed specifications.

Required Qualifications

  • Active TS/SCI clearance (mandatory).
  • Bachelor’s in Computer Science/Engineering + 12 years development experience.
  • Expertise in Python and C/C++ for offensive cyber tools.
  • Proven offensive cyber programming for U.S. Government or commercial clients.
  • Advanced knowledge of network protocols, routers, and security.

Preferred Skills

  • Firmware/embedded systems reverse engineering.
  • Assembly programming.
  • Tools like IDA Pro and Ghidra for embedded firmware analysis.
  • Automated testing frameworks and Docker/container orchestration.
